Property Listings — Secaucus, NJ

As of Oct '25, Realtor.com reports that the median days on market for a home in Secaucus, NJ is 31. This is a increase of 27.0% from last year, suggesting that homes are sitting on the market longer than last year. The percentage of listed homes with a reduced price is 12.0%, representing a small inventory and little supply pressure on home prices.

Demographics — Secaucus, NJ

As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Secaucus, NJ has a population of 21,400, which has increased by 10.6% over the past 5 years. Secaucus, NJ is a moderately popular place for families, as children make up 20.6% of the population. The area has a highly educated workforce, with 62.7% of adult residents holding a bachelor’s degree or higher. There are some residents working remotely, with 23.0% reporting working from home.

As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Secaucus, NJ is a predominantly white area, with 35.8% of the population identifying as white. The white population has shrunk by 22.5% in the last 5 years. The second most common race or ethnicity in Secaucus, NJ is asian, making up 34.5% of the population. Foreign-born residents account for 42.9% of the population in Secaucus, NJ, and this percentage has increased by 21.2% as of the ACS Survey 5 years prior, suggesting more immigrants are calling the area home.

Mortgage and Risk — Secaucus, NJ

According to HUD data as of 2023, there were 204 mortgage originations in Secaucus, NJ, of which 94.0% of loans were conventional mortgages. The average loan-to-value was 62.0%, with 17.0% above 90% LTV (elevated). This implies medium mortgage risk in Secaucus, NJ. Investor activity is low, as 4.0% of loans were by investors. 6.0% of loans were cash-out refinances, suggesting few homeowners are tapping equity.

Rentals and Section 8 — Secaucus, NJ

As of 2024, the percent of homes in Secaucus, NJ under the Section 8 program is 12.5%. This is considered low, suggesting that the neighborhood is sparsely composed of Section 8 homes. Section 8 opportunity is good when HUD pays more than market rent. 1-bedroom units appear to be good home sizes to consider for Section 8 housing in Secaucus, NJ, because HUD payments exceed market rent, while 2-bedroom and 3-bedroom and 4-bedroom units do not.
